TARDIS: Time And Relative Delays In Simulation
[article]
2020
IACR Cryptology ePrint Archive
This work introduces an extension of the UC framework with an abstract notion of time that allows for modeling relative delays in communication and sequential computation without requiring parties to keep track of a clock.
